Dr. Blair Lewis is a gastroenterologist practicing in New York, NY. Dr. Lewis specializes in the digestive system and its diseases that affect the gastrointestinal tract, which include organs from the mouth to the anus as well as liver disorders. Gastroenterology includes conditions such as hepatitis, peptic ulcer disease, colitis, nutritional problems and irritable bowel syndrome. Dr. Lewis performs colonoscopy and endoscopy procedures and provides accurate and thorough care for patients suffering from digestive issues.

- What Are the Symptoms of Gallstones?
Gallstones are hardened, stone-like particles formed from the contents of the gallbladder. The stones vary in size, from very small grains to the size of a golf ball.
